From 020a4d6dccfa25235a1481efc3e449a73a0d659a Mon Sep 17 00:00:00 2001
From: James Moger <james.moger@gitblit.com>
Date: Thu, 24 Oct 2013 08:12:03 -0400
Subject: [PATCH] Merge pull request #119 from simonharrer/fix-locale-test-run-bug
---
src/main/java/com/gitblit/FileSettings.java | 11 ++++++-----
1 files changed, 6 insertions(+), 5 deletions(-)
diff --git a/src/main/java/com/gitblit/FileSettings.java b/src/main/java/com/gitblit/FileSettings.java
index 3a42cad..12739d2 100644
--- a/src/main/java/com/gitblit/FileSettings.java
+++ b/src/main/java/com/gitblit/FileSettings.java
@@ -26,9 +26,9 @@
/**
* Dynamically loads and reloads a properties file by keeping track of the last
* modification date.
- *
+ *
* @author James Moger
- *
+ *
*/
public class FileSettings extends IStoredSettings {
@@ -37,7 +37,7 @@
private final Properties properties = new Properties();
private volatile long lastModified;
-
+
private volatile boolean forceReload;
public FileSettings(String file) {
@@ -83,6 +83,7 @@
/**
* Updates the specified settings in the settings file.
*/
+ @Override
public synchronized boolean saveSettings(Map<String, String> settings) {
String content = FileUtils.readContent(propertiesFile, "\n");
for (Map.Entry<String, String> setting:settings.entrySet()) {
@@ -98,11 +99,11 @@
}
FileUtils.writeContent(propertiesFile, content);
// manually set the forceReload flag because not all JVMs support real
- // millisecond resolution of lastModified. (issue-55)
+ // millisecond resolution of lastModified. (issue-55)
forceReload = true;
return true;
}
-
+
private String regExEscape(String input) {
return input.replace(".", "\\.").replace("$", "\\$").replace("{", "\\{");
}
--
Gitblit v1.9.1